RF Operational Characteristics
Your phone contains a transmitter and a receiver. When it is ON, it receives and
transmits radio frequency (RF) energy. The phone operates in the frequency range of
806 MHz to 870 MHz and employs digital modulation techniques.
When you communicate with your phone, the system handling your call controls the
power level at which your phone transmits. The output power level typically may vary
over a range from 0.0025 watts to 0.6 watts.
